The capital will be used for the training of GPT-5 and beyond, and for the massive data centers required to support it. Let's look at the technical reality. A model like GPT-4 costs hundreds of millions to train. The inference cost—the cost to run the model for users—is also staggering. Now, extrapolate that to the scale of a true AGI, a model that can perform any intellectual task a human can. The amount of compute is not linear; it is exponential. The wall of compute needed is the physical limit that Altman is trying to buy his way through.
The key insight, which is my first bit of original analysis, is that this is not just about hardware. It is about energy. You cannot train a model of this magnitude without a massive amount of energy. I am talking about gigawatts, the power consumption of a city. This move signals a shift from the digital to the physical. The money will not only go to Nvidia for GPUs, but to nuclear power plants, geothermal contracts, and the construction of new power plants. This is the untold story of AI infrastructure. This is the true bottleneck. The tech world is finally realizing that the resource is the world's energy grid, and this is where the true competition will occur. This is not a story about Moore's Law; it is a story about the supply of physical energy and the control of it.
